Home
last modified time | relevance | path

Searched refs:unmap_list (Results 1 – 3 of 3) sorted by relevance

/linux-4.1.27/net/rds/
Dib_rdma.c55 struct list_head unmap_list; member
536 list_add_tail(&ibmr->unmap_list, list); in llist_append_to_list()
555 list_for_each_entry(ibmr, list, unmap_list) { in list_to_llist_nodes()
576 LIST_HEAD(unmap_list); in rds_ib_flush_mr_pool()
621 llist_append_to_list(&pool->drop_list, &unmap_list); in rds_ib_flush_mr_pool()
622 llist_append_to_list(&pool->free_list, &unmap_list); in rds_ib_flush_mr_pool()
624 llist_append_to_list(&pool->clean_list, &unmap_list); in rds_ib_flush_mr_pool()
628 if (list_empty(&unmap_list)) in rds_ib_flush_mr_pool()
632 list_for_each_entry(ibmr, &unmap_list, unmap_list) in rds_ib_flush_mr_pool()
640 list_for_each_entry_safe(ibmr, next, &unmap_list, unmap_list) { in rds_ib_flush_mr_pool()
[all …]
Diw_rdma.c86 struct list_head *unmap_list,
485 LIST_HEAD(unmap_list);
497 list_splice_init(&pool->dirty_list, &unmap_list);
510 if (!list_empty(&unmap_list)) {
511 ncleaned = rds_iw_unmap_fastreg_list(pool, &unmap_list,
516 list_splice_init(&unmap_list, &kill_list);
530 if (!list_empty(&unmap_list)) {
532 list_splice(&unmap_list, &pool->clean_list);
824 struct list_head *unmap_list, argument
848 while (!list_empty(unmap_list)) {
[all …]
/linux-4.1.27/drivers/infiniband/core/
Dfmr_pool.c141 LIST_HEAD(unmap_list); in ib_fmr_batch_release()
159 list_splice_init(&pool->dirty_list, &unmap_list); in ib_fmr_batch_release()
164 if (list_empty(&unmap_list)) { in ib_fmr_batch_release()
173 list_splice(&unmap_list, &pool->free_list); in ib_fmr_batch_release()